лучше заюзай CSS. я обычно для адаптивности (хотя использую бутстраповый слайдер, не суть) картинки подключаю через background-image: url(...) , а дальше выставляю для фона свойства, которые и вносят адаптивность в слайдер. то есть position center, size cover (иногда contain, судя по разрешениям картинок) ну и no-repeat, для точности. а потом блокам даю несколько медиа запросов и кидаю туда разные ширины и высоты для разных экранов. Работает на ура.